Fabric Weaves

Plain Weave

StarStarStarStar

Simple and strong, over-under pattern, balances stability and breathability.

Twill Weave

StarStarStarStar

Diagonal ridges, durable and drapes well, used for denim and tweed.

Satin Weave

StarStarStarStar

Smooth, glossy surface, floats over weave pattern, elegant appearance

Herringbone Weave

StarStarStarStar

Broken twill pattern, distinct V-shaped weaving, creates a reversible pattern.

Basket Weave

StarStarStarStar

Variation of plain weave, two or more threads woven together, looks like a woven basket.

Jacquard Weave

StarStarStarStar

Complex patterns, uses special Jacquard loom, ideal for brocade and damask fabrics.

Dobby Weave

StarStarStarStar

Geometric or textured patterns, controlled by the dobby attachment, versatile weave type.

Leno Weave

StarStarStarStar

Open, airy weave, twisted warp threads, often used for mesh or netting.

Oxford Weave

StarStarStarStar

Basket weave variation, combines two warp threads with one weft thread, commonly used for dress shirts.

Pile Weave

StarStarStarStar

Cut or uncut loops create a 'pile', soft and plush texture, used for velvet and terry cloth.
